Output 31fc37138df066e8b9dbbcd166c84a5e40629a565273e634eee0ee6982db3492:0

value
421801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1b20de230d24282bdc9cb070bfd25d97b57c6d OP_EQUAL
address
3ETq2K95UmUr4Gv72nhFVP8ifJkKLP5qtU
transaction
31fc37138df066e8b9dbbcd166c84a5e40629a565273e634eee0ee6982db3492
spent
true